## Step 4: Taming cold starts

Welcome aboard! When we moved Fernwick's order-intake handlers to serverless, cold starts jumped to ~3s, which annoyed everyone in the Larkspur region. The fix is pre-warming: we keep two provisioned instances per handler and trim memory so init stays under 400ms. Don't guess at these numbers — they took weeks of tuning. Copy the current settings exactly as shown below.

settings of tawep-kageg:
[sorwyn]
port = 9090
region = north-3
host = sorwyn.tolvaqsys.internal
timeout_ms = 2000
retries = 1

Subject: Handover — Echotrail audio-guide release

Taking over from me effective Monday. Echotrail 4.1 for the Varnholt Museum ships Thursday; build is frozen, store listing approved. Remaining tasks: tag the release, upload the signed bundle, notify curators. Pipeline docs are on the wiki. You'll need to register the deploy key yourself before tagging. Here it is:

rollout seal: bky4_yke3

HANDOVER — KEY-CARD STOCK, NEW GRELLING POINT SITE

For the office manager: 250 blank key-cards plus 20 pre-encoded supervisor cards, packed in two sealed boxes. Encoded cards are live — treat as controlled stock. Counts verified against the order from Tessor Access Systems; discrepancy sheet is empty. Boxes go out tomorrow on the first run. Do not split the shipment. The courier hand-over instruction is given on the line directly below.

courier memo of yahif-faweg: the quenael tamius courier leaves the prawyn jorix kaswyn istox silmir brieth zormir fenvan ledger at gate 3145 under passcode 231062

## Kiosk Watchdog — Session Handling

The Pondera kiosk watchdog resets idle sessions after 90 seconds and force-restarts the shell if the heartbeat misses three intervals. Sessions are keyed per device, not per user; do not ship builds that persist session state across restarts. Before each release, the manager must run the watchdog smoke suite against the Bramblegate staging fleet and confirm clean session teardown in the logs. The smoke suite authenticates to the staging fleet controller using the bearer token below.

session JWT of yawep-yawep = eyJhbGciOiJIUzI1NiIsInR5cCI6IkpXVCJ9.eyJzdWIiOiI3pWF3_In0.aXYsHiog